Defining the Core Concept

An announcement is a formal declaration or public notification that broadcasts information to a targeted group. It is the mechanism by which entities—whether a corporation, a government body, a community, or an individual—disseminate critical information efficiently. The purpose is not merely to share data, but to manage expectations, provide clarity, and guide action. Effective announcements cut through noise by delivering a clear message regarding a specific development, thereby eliminating ambiguity and fostering transparency.

The Strategic Role in Communication

In the modern information ecosystem, the role of an announcement is strategic rather than merely informational. Organizations leverage announcements to control the narrative surrounding a new initiative or a significant change. By being the first to communicate, they prevent misinformation from spreading and establish authority. This proactive approach to communication builds credibility and trust, as audiences come to rely on these updates as a primary source for understanding the direction of the entity they follow.

Key Objectives of Effective Announcements

Information Dissemination: Rapidly sharing vital details to a wide audience.

Expectation Management: Setting clear guidelines regarding timelines, policies, or outcomes.

Reputation Management: Presenting news in a way that maintains or enhances public perception.

Call to Action: Directing the audience on specific steps they need to take, such as adopting a new policy or visiting a website.

Diverse Channels and Mediums

The method of delivery is crucial to the success of an announcement. The channel must align with the audience and the urgency of the message. A major corporate restructuring might be delivered via a live press conference and a formal email, while a minor schedule change for a local event might be sufficient via a social media post or a digital banner. The medium dictates the tone and structure of the message, ensuring it resonates with the intended recipients.

Common Distribution Methods

Channel
Best Use Case
Email
Internal updates, formal notices, and detailed press releases.
Social Media
Public engagement, quick updates, and viral potential.
Press Releases
Official statements to media outlets and the general public.
Company Website
Permanent records, blog posts, and dedicated newsrooms.
Internal Messaging
Town halls, digital signage, and intranet posts for employees.

Crafting a Clear and Impactful Message

Writing an effective announcement requires precision and empathy. The message should answer the fundamental questions of who, what, when, where, and why immediately. The language must be accessible, avoiding jargon that might alienate parts of the audience. A strong announcement balances factual accuracy with a human touch, acknowledging the impact the news will have on the recipients. The structure should guide the reader logically from the most critical information to the necessary next steps.
